WebMar 6, 2024 · The Nehru Committee Report 1928 was a memo to support an appeal for a new provincial autonomy and a federal system of administration for the Indian constitution (accepted on August 28, 1928). Additionally, it suggested that seats be reserved for minorities in the legislatures under the Joint Electorates. WebIn February, 1928, the Congress called an All Parties Conference, in which representatives of all different parties like Congress, Hindu Mahasabha, Muslim league etc. were met under the president ship of Dr. M.A. Ansari with aim of establishing full Dominion self-government. And on 19 May 1928, a committee was appointed under Motilal Nehru to ...

WebFourteen Points of Jinnah. The Fourteen Points of Jinnah were proposed by Muhammad Ali Jinnah in response to the Nehru report.
